About this property
Comfortable Accommodations: THE Waterloo Arms Hotel in Chirnside offers family rooms with private bathrooms, tea and coffee makers, and free toiletries. Each room includes a carpeted floor, electric kettle, and free WiFi. Dining and Leisure: Guests can enjoy a restaurant and bar, with a child-friendly buffet and outdoor seating area. The hotel features a terrace, garden, and picnic area, ideal for relaxation. Convenient Location: Located 91 km from Edinburgh Airport, the hotel is near attractions such as The Maltings Theatre & Cinema (15 km) and Lindisfarne Castle (38 km). Free on-site parking is available. Guest Services: The property staff provide excellent service support, including housekeeping and breakfast. Additional amenities include a kitchen, dining area, and interconnected rooms.
